31.05.2015

Еженедельный отчет о марафоне. Неделя 2

На этой неделе отчет будет скучный. Многое переосмыслил, прочитал много полезной информации. Сейчас жду заказанные книги для лучшего изучения вопросов, которые мне интересны.

На этой неделе опять пришло просветление - осваиваю моделирование под паттерн Конечный Автомат (Fine State Machine). Тема как-то фоном блуждает уже почти год, но все не получала должного развития. В итоге неделя больше теоретическая.

Отметил интересную особенность - неосознанно перешел от "разработчика"  к "внедренцу". Возникло желание по-быстрому закончить проект, что бы заняться другими интересными темами. Часть времени ушло на анализ состояния и выяснение причин такой смены подхода. В итоге остановился, что и привело к FSM.

До идей про FSM удалось проработать вопрос разделения логики от представления, но несмотря на все мои попытки, код пока что страшный, сильносвязный. Посмотрим, что будет дальше.

Следующая неделя будет короткой - 6 июня уезжаю в "настоящий отпуск", поэтому максимальная цель - это реализовать базовый FSM под мои задачи. НЕ уверен, что получится, и возможно к вопросу вернусь 15 июня. Вообще сложно совмещать велосипед, который отъедает два-три часа в день минимум, работу и обучение. Но никто не говорил, что будет легко.

Комментариев нет:

Отправить комментарий